J. M. Lambert is a scholar working on Plant Science, Nature and Landscape Conservation and Ecology. According to data from OpenAlex, J. M. Lambert has authored 31 papers receiving a total of 1.3k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 15 papers in Plant Science, 6 papers in Nature and Landscape Conservation and 5 papers in Ecology. Recurrent topics in J. M. Lambert's work include Botany and Plant Ecology Studies (10 papers), Ecology and Vegetation Dynamics Studies (4 papers) and Geology and Paleoclimatology Research (3 papers). J. M. Lambert is often cited by papers focused on Botany and Plant Ecology Studies (10 papers), Ecology and Vegetation Dynamics Studies (4 papers) and Geology and Paleoclimatology Research (3 papers). J. M. Lambert coll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om. J. M. Lambert's co-authors include W. T. Williams, B. R. Buttery, P. J. Goodman, J. N. Jennings, William T. Williams, C. J. Marchant, Charles Green, J. N. Hutchinson, C. T. Smith and Joanna Sofaer and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ature, Journal of Ecology and Journal of Animal Ecology.
